VIDEO: Short-staffed Oilers fall 3-2 to Camrose

OKOTOKS, AB (October 16, 2021) ““ Once again missing seven regulars from the lineup, the Okotoks Oilers (7-5) dropped a 3-2 decision to the visiting Camrose Kodiaks on Saturday night in front of 702 fans at the Pason Centennial Arena.

The Oilers erased a 2-0 deficit with back to back goals in the second, but a tipped point shot by Graydon Gotaas of the Kodiaks in the third period ended up being the difference.

Camrose got back to back goals from Michael Lovsin on a tipped shot at 8:18 and a net-front deflection off the rush at 11:20 to build their initial lead, despite the Oilers outshooting the Kodiaks 11-6 in the opening frame.

In the second, it was the Oilers converting twice despite being outshot 11-8. Jagger Tapper (Calgary, AB) scored his first AJHL goal in his second game as an affiliate with the team, pouncing on a puck in the slot off a setup from Dean Spak (Calgary, AB) and rifling home a top shelf wrister to get his team on the board. 2:40 later, Nolan Flint (Beaverlodge, AB) took a pass from Sam Huck (Calgary, AB) off the half-wall, drove in front all alone and flipped a backhander over goalie Logan Willcott to tie the game up.

But the Kodiaks had the last laugh at 2:04 of the third when Gotaas fired a wrister from the mid-blue line that ricocheted off two skates and past Austin Zavoda (Hershey, PA) to notch the 3-2 final. Zavoda otherwise made 26 solid saves as the Oilers were outshot 29-26 in the game.

Okotoks will remain at Pason for the final two games of their seven-game homestand with a Friday night matchup with the Lloydminster Bobcats and Saturday night battle with Whitecourt, who beat the Oilers at the AJHL Showcase.
